Best Condition I've seen this course Ever..

I moved from augusta four years ago and would play this course one or two times a year over the 10 years I lived there. Course conditions today were outstanding, along with the lightning fast greens.

Played from the white tees, which is not very long, but the greens are small and undulating which is where the difficulty in scoring arises. Experience and some book work are really needed to insure you hit into the greens on the correct side to insure you are below the hole.
Course is in best shape ever and saw very little play today..

Very Poor Condition

I have played this course several times & this was by far the worst condition I've seen it in. There is hardly any grass growing on the fairways or the roughs. Almost all of the tees were completely devoid of grass & hard as rock. I had to resort to pounding my tee into the ground with my club head in order to tee up. It is hard for me to fathom that the late spring condition is actually worse than it was over the winter. Looks like they haven't watered the course in weeks. The one upside was the greens were in very good condition. This is a fun course to play & I was very disappointed in its' current condition.
